Output d762902ec4bfc2689142519cb33c703e6336283830d5b25753f0f919b4c3c874:1

value
5730147
script pubkey
OP_0 OP_PUSHBYTES_20 e5ec77c6f6066c656e37af11d98c2fc38320b905
address
bc1quhk803hkqekx2m3h4uganrp0cwpjpwg99hkclg
transaction
d762902ec4bfc2689142519cb33c703e6336283830d5b25753f0f919b4c3c874